10 Electric Vehicle Models in Five Years:
Tata Motors already has two cars in its electric vehicle portfolio, Nexon and Tigor. Nexon Electric is selling well in the Indian market. Now by bringing the Tiago, the company will stake its claim in the hatchback electric segment as well. Tata Motors aims to launch 10 electric vehicle models in the next five years. Tiago Electric is also one of them.
Tata Tiago Electric Price:
Talking about the prices of Tata Tiago Electric, it can come in the range of 10 lakh rupees. The company claims that it will be the cheapest electric car in the country. Tata Tiago Electric has a great range. It can cover a distance of about 300 km on a single charge. It can be equipped with a 26kWh battery pack.
The company is already selling the Tigor EV, one of the cheapest electric vehicles in the domestic market. Its price is 12.49 lakh rupees. On the other hand, other electric vehicle manufacturers are offering their cars at prices above Rs 20 lakh. Other EV makers are selling their vehicles for over Rs 20 lakh.
Tata Motors has achieved 88 percent share in the electric passenger vehicle market in India based on its Nexon EV and Tigor EV. The company has sold 3,845 electric vehicles including Nexon EV Prime, Nexon EV Max and Tigor EV in August 2022. The new Tiago EV is claimed to feature features like cruise control. The charging time of the new EV may also be similar to that of the Tigor EV. It is expected that the Tigor EV will charge from 0-80 percent in around 65 minutes.
